OnLive beta sign-ups online now

Newly-announced Cloud-based gaming service OnLive has put up its beta sign-up form here.
The beta is scheduled to take place this summer. To get involved, “You need to be at least 18, based in the US and have a broadband-connected PC running Windows Vista/XP, or an Intel-based Mac.”
OnLive is aiming for a late 2009 launch.
